Medenine Airport
Medenine Airfield is an abandoned military airfield in Tunisia, which was located just to the west of Medenine, 46 km N of Tataouine; 430 km south-southeast of Tunis.- Type: Aerodrome
- Description: abandoned World War II military airfield in Tunisia
- Also known as: “Medenine Airfield”

Medenine is the major town in south-eastern Tunisia, 77 kilometres south of the port of Gabès and the Island of Djerba, on the main route to Libya. It is the capital of Medenine Governorate.
